Bailey Gulch is a valley in Jackson, Oregon and has an elevation of 1,663 feet.| Tap on a place to explore it |
- Type: Valley with an elevation of 1,663 feet
- Description: valley in Jackson County, United States of America - Geonames ID = 5712130
- Category: landform
- Location: Jackson, Oregon, Pacific Northwest, United States, North America
